Walk into Wellness on the Firefly Trail

The Athens-Clarke County Leisure Services Department, in partnership with Firefly Trail, Inc., Piedmont Athens Regional, and UGA Extension will host a “Walk into Wellness” series.

Walk your way into wellness one step at a time while getting out to meet others in your neighbors in the community who are also on the path to wellness. Each walk will focus on a different health topic. 

This free program is open to ages eight and older.  Each session is held from 10:00 a.m. – 11:00 a.m. with participants meeting at the Dudley Park Picnic Pavilion.

The summer series takes place Saturdays, August 10, 17, 24, and 31

For more information call 706-613-3620.
